Meaning of the Name

Ashleah is a feminine Christian name meaning 'meadow of ash trees,' evoking peaceful natural imagery and spiritual connection to creation. The name suggests a person who embodies both the resilience of trees and the gentle openness of meadows.

Cultural & Historical Significance

Ashleah represents a modern evolution in Christian naming practices, where families seek to maintain traditional values while expressing individuality through unique spellings. The name's connection to nature aligns with Christian themes of stewardship and appreciation for God's creation, making it particularly meaningful for families with environmental consciousness or rural backgrounds. Historically, the ash tree has held significance in various cultures as a symbol of protection and healing, which Christian tradition adapts to represent spiritual shelter and growth. The meadow imagery evokes biblical references to green pastures and peaceful landscapes, creating a name that embodies both natural beauty and spiritual serenity within contemporary Christian identity.
